Transaction 5d37b76cf2c17a72722218157dd44137b392a99774cbd47184361bf211b14e75

1 Input
2 Outputs
  • 5d37b76cf2c17a72722218157dd44137b392a99774cbd47184361bf211b14e75:0
  • value  3070095
    address  37jcgBBXMP2bDobTkBTRKu9FbVT6471KQd
  • 5d37b76cf2c17a72722218157dd44137b392a99774cbd47184361bf211b14e75:1
  • value  19048471
    address  15vL88rHLjpKCq7GCtwZ8MHsWTQssRn5Tp